Comprehending Car Locksmith Services

A car locksmith is a specialized locksmith who focuses on automotive locks and keys. They are equipped to manage a vast array of concerns, from simple key duplications to complex elect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miths, in particular, are experts who can concern your area,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the roadway, to provide instant assistance.

Services Offered by Car Locksmiths

  1. Key Duplication

    • Standard Keys: If you require an extra key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can rapidly duplicate your existing key.
    • Remote Keys: For vehicles with keyless entry systems, car locksmiths can program and replicate remote keys, ensuring you can open and begin your car without issues.
  2. Lockout Assistance

    • ** unlocking Doors **: If you've locked your type in the car, a mobile car locksmith can safely open your vehicle without causing dam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
    • Ignition Lockout: For scenarios where you can't start your car since the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can assist extract it.
  3. Key Replacement

    • Lost Keys: If you've lost your car key, a locksmith can produce a new one using the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.
    • Broken Keys: If your key is harmed or broken, a locksmith can replace it and ensure the brand-new key works flawlessly with your car.
  4. Transponder Key Programming

    • New Keys: Many modern cars featured transponder keys, which require programming to the car's onboard computer. A professional car locksmith can program a new transponder key to ensure it works correctly.
    • Reprogramming: If your transponder key has actually quit working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its functionality.
  5. Lock Installation and Repair

    • New Locks: If your car's locks are used out or harmed, a car locksmith can set up brand-new, high-quality locks.
    • Lock Repair: For small issues like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to ensure smooth operation.
  6. Security Upgrades

    • High-Security Locks: For added comfort, a car locksmith can set up high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.
    • Immobilizer Systems: These advanced security systems avoid your car from beginning if the right key is not present. A car locksmith can install and program immobilizer systems.

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Locksmith Services

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ith assistance if I lock my type in the car?

  • A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can safely open your car without triggering any damage. They are geared up with tools and strategies to manage numerous lockout circumstances.

Q2: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made?

  • A2: The cost can vary depending on the type of key and the complexity of the vehicle's lock system. Standard ke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.

Q3: Can a locksmith program a new transponder key?

  • A3: Yes, an expert car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to your vehicle's onboard computer system. This is a common service for contemporary lorries that require this kind of key.

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?

  • A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to require it out. Rather, call a mobile car locksmith who can safely extract the broken key and provide a replacement if needed.

Q5: How can I avoid being locked out of my car?

  • A5: Keep a spare type in a safe place, such as a relied on good friend's home or a secure key box. Regularly examine your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by a professional locksmith.

Tips for Maintaining Your Car Locks and Keys

  1. Routine Lubrication

    • Use a silicone-based lubricant to keep your locks and keys moving smoothly. This can avoid wear and tear and reduce the risk of lockouts.
  2. Avoid Excessive Force

    • When inserting or turning your key, prevent using extreme force. This can damage the lock or key and lead to more major issues.
  3. Keep Your Keys Safe

    • Shop your car keys in a safe and secure and accessible location. Avoid putting them near windows or in areas where they can be easily stolen.
  4. Check Locks Regularly

    • Routinely inspect your car locks for any indications of wear, rust, or damage. If you discover any concerns, have them checked and fixed by an expert locksmith.
  5. Consider Keyless Entry Systems

    • If your vehicle supports it, consider upgrading to a keyless entry system. These systems can lower the danger of lockouts and supply additional security.
